Abstract

El autor del libro aquí reseñado, Marcelo Hoffman, distinguido académico y profesor en el Departamento de Ciencias Políticas del Dyson College of Arts and Sciences en Pace University, Nueva York, es conocido por su erudición en el ámbito de la teoría política y el pensamiento filosófico. Hoffman, escritor de los influyentes títulos Militant Acts: The Role of Investigations in Radical Political Struggles (2019) y Foucault and Power: The Influence of Political Engagement on Theories of Power (2015), presenta en esta ocasión la publicación de Foucault in Brazil. Dictatorship, Resistance, and Solidarity, un análisis rigurosamente perspicaz sobre un capítulo menos rastreado de la vida y obra del filósofo Michel Foucault: su relación con Brasil.
